Title: CAM CHOICE WITH SUMMIT VORTEC HEADS
Post by: cliffw1210 on March 14, 2012, 11:49:47 am
I got a set of Summit Racing Vortec Heads, and specs say it will take a .510 lift, but whats a good choice size cam to run with these. Any suggestions? I appreciate any comments. I am building a 355, flattop pistons (2 valve reliefs) new eagle crank, and new rods... That's all i have so far.
Title: Re: CAM CHOICE WITH SUMMIT VORTEC HEADS
Post by: SAATR on March 14, 2012, 01:00:44 pm
What are your honest intentions for the truck?  Street/strip, all out drag, daily driver, tow/haul?  This, your tire size, gears, transmission type, weight, compression, exhaust type, etc etc make a huge difference in your cam selection.   Most manufacturers have websites that let you spec out what you're doing and let them choose a cam that fits.  That's the route I'd go.  Just remember,  be honest with yourself about what you want.
